CULTURE NEWS

  • On May 8, the History of the Heartland commissioned a limited-edition elongated coin featuring an image of an iconic Wabash Diesel Engine that honors Decatur’s railroad legacy. The coin will be given free to the first 20 attendees at Historic Preservation Week events from May 12 to May 18+.  Now Decatur

EDUCATION NEWS

  • Millikin University will hold its final Public Observation Night on Tuesday, May 13 from 7:30–9:30 p.m. on the roof of the Leighty-Tabor Science Center—guests can enter via the southeast door off Fairview Avenue to enjoy free stargazing with top telescopic equipment, weather permitting.  Now Decatur

GOVERNMENT NEWS

  • Today, the Decatur Police Department promoted Erik Ethell to Deputy Chief of Administrative Operations—he will succeed Brad Allen, who was appointed Police Chief, as Ethell brings 17 years of service since joining in May 2008.  ABC 20
  • On May 8th, former mayor Paul Osborne joined Byers & Co to discuss the financial importance of tourism, Farm Progress, God’s Shelter of Love, political theatrics, and a downtown market legacy—points he said underscore key issues in local financing.  Now Decatur

HEALTH NEWS

  • HSHS St. Mary’s Hospital AthletiCare will offer $25 cash sports physicals on-site for student athletes in grades 5, 7, 8, 10 and 12 during the school year, with events starting May 12 at Unity Christian School, followed by sessions at Mt. Zion High School on May 30, Warrensburg-Latham High School on June 13 and MacArthur High School on August 11+ the Stone Thrown Forward Foundation will provide additional heart screenings as needed.  Now Decatur
